For 루프

(For에서 넘어옴)


24px-Disambig_grey.svg.png 다른 뜻에 대해서는 포문 문서를 참조하십시오.
for
for문

1 Bash[편집]

16px-Crystal_Clear_app_xmag.svg.png Bash for 문서를 참고하십시오.
for (( i = 1; i < 4; i++ )); do
	echo "i = $i"
done
# i = 1
# i = 2
# i = 3
for i in $(seq 1 3); do
	echo "i = $i"
done
for i in `seq 1 3`; do
	echo "i = $i"
done
for i in {1..3}; do
	echo "i = $i"
done
i=1
while [ $i -lt 4 ]; do
	echo "i = $i"
	i=`expr $i + 1`
done
for i in 2 3 5; do
	echo "i = $i"
done
# i = 2
# i = 3
# i = 5

2 C[편집]

for(int i=1; i<=10; i++) {
	sum += i;
}

3 CMD[편집]

(@echo off & for /L %i in (1,1,4) do echo i = %i) & echo on
REM i = 1
REM i = 2
REM i = 3
REM i = 4

4 Java[편집]

for(int i=1; i<=10; i++) {
	sum += i;
}

5 JavaScript[편집]

for(var i=1; i<=10; i++) {
	sum += i;
}

6 PHP[편집]

16px-Crystal_Clear_app_xmag.svg.png PHP for 문서를 참고하십시오.
$sum = 0;
for($i=1; $i<=10; $i++) {
	$sum += $i;
}
echo $sum;

7 Python[편집]

16px-Crystal_Clear_app_xmag.svg.png 파이썬 for 문서를 참고하십시오.
sum = 0
for i in range(10):
	sum += i
print sum

8 Perl[편집]

16px-Crystal_Clear_app_xmag.svg.png 펄 for 문서를 참고하십시오.
my $sum = 0;
for $i (1..4) {
	$sum += $i;
}
printf("$sum\n");
# 10

9 Ruby[편집]

sum = 0
for i in 1..4
	sum += i
end
puts sum
# 10
sum = 0
for i in 1...5
	sum += i
end
puts sum
# 10
sum = 0
(1..4).each { |i| sum += i }
puts sum
# 10
sum = 0
(1..4).each do |i|
    sum += i
end
puts sum
# 10
sum = 0
[1, 2, 3, 4].each { |i| sum += i }
puts sum
# 10

10 Visual Basic[편집]

FOR I = 1 TO 10
	SUM = SUM + I
NEXT I

11 같이 보기[편집]

문서 댓글 ({{ doc_comments.length }})
{{ comment.name }} {{ comment.created | snstime }}